Effect of Hypertonic Sucrose on the Growth of Salmonella typhi in Experimental Blood Cultures
Chong, Yunsop
Yi, Kui Nyung/Lee, Samuel Y.
Abstract
Slower growth of S. typhi in hypertonic media, reported previously by the authors, was contradictory to other workers¢¥ results which showed better growth of some species of bacteria. To evaluate furthur the effect of hypertonic sucrose on the growth of S. typhi, organisms were suspended in saline or in blood with or without sodium polyanethol sulfonate (SPS) and stored up to 24 hours. And then viable counts were determined on tryptic soy agar (TSA) and experimental blood cultures were done in tryptic soy broth (TSB) and in TSB with 10% sucrose (TSB-H). S. typhi, suspended in blood and kept for 24 hours, were inoculated into TSB and TSB-H and after 4 hour incubation viable counts were made on TSA and on TSA with 10% sucrose (TSA-H).
In this study it was found that, during the 24 hour storage, the viable counts of S. typhi suspended in saline with or without SPS were similar and those suspended in blood with SPS were increasing.
Comparison of the growth in TSB and in TSB-H did not show hyperonic media was better for the cultivation of S. typhi which was kept up to 24 hours before inoculation. On the contrary the growth was slower. Viable counts made on TSA and on TSA-H from the TSB and TSB-H, which were inoculated with S. typhi suspended in blood and incubated for 4 hours, showed similar results indicating TSB-H did not support faster growth.
From the results of this experiment and of the previous clinical blood cultures, it is concluded that 0.1 % SPS does not give adverse effect on S. typhi during the 24 hour storage and that hypertonic sucrose does not give better result in the cultivation of S. typhi.
